FREE CloudPro for all existing customers.
Date: 05/01/2015 4:52 pm | Posted by: Jason Barnes | Read Full
FREE CloudPro for all existing customers.
CloudatCost is offering for a limited time existing customers which have purchased servers using the "OneTime" option can migrate FREE to CloudPRO service with no monthly costs.CloudPro is the next generation of CloudatCost which will soon offer many extra features such as multi datacenter, redundant networks, additional OS Choices, advanced API and many more features scheduled for release in the next few weeks.
To migrate your existing server resources simply login to the panel at https://panel.cloudatcost.com, find your server you wish to migrate and select the "Migrate" option.
Please ensure you backup your data.
Once completed you can click CloudPRO and you will see all your resources you can start using.
